The Omron BP710 is a fully automatic upper arm blood pressure monitor with IntelliSense technology for accurate and comfortable measurement. It features a large, easy-to-read display, hypertension indicator, irregular heartbeat detection, memory storage for up to 100 readings with date and time, body movement detection, and a wide-range D-Ring cuff (22-42 cm). Key components: Main unit, D-Ring Cuff, AC Adapter, Instruction Manual, Storage Case.
| Feature | Description |
|---|---|
| IntelliSense Technology | Automatically inflates to the optimal level for comfortable measurement |
| Hypertension Indicator | Displays warning symbol if systolic/diastolic readings are high |
| Irregular Heartbeat Detection | Detects and displays an icon if an irregular rhythm is detected during measurement |
| 100 Memory Storage | Stores up to 100 readings with date and time stamp |
| Body Movement Detection | Alerts user if movement is detected during measurement |
| D-Ring Cuff (22-42 cm) | Pre-formed, wide-range cuff for easy self-application |
| Large LCD Display | Easy-to-read backlit display with clear icons |
| Average Reading | Calculates the average of the last 3 readings taken within 10 minutes |
| AC Adapter & Battery Operation | Powered by 4 AA batteries or included AC adapter |
| Automatic Power Off | Conserves battery life by turning off after 1 minute of inactivity |

Tip: For first use, take a few practice measurements to become familiar with the process.
For most accurate results, measure at the same time each day, before taking medication or eating.
WARNING! Do not inflate cuff without it being properly wrapped on arm. Wait at least 3 minutes between consecutive measurements on the same person.
| Icon/Symbol | Meaning |
|---|---|
| SYS / mmHg | Systolic Pressure Reading |
| DIA / mmHg | Diastolic Pressure Reading |
| Pulse Icon & Value | Pulse Rate in beats per minute |
| Hypertension Indicator | Flashing if systolic ≥135 or diastolic ≥85 (based on home monitoring guidelines) |
| Irregular Heartbeat Icon | Appears if an irregular rhythm is detected during measurement |
| Body Movement Icon | Appears if excessive movement is detected; measurement may be inaccurate |
| Memory Index (e.g., 001) | Current memory position of displayed reading |
| Average Icon (AVG) | Displayed when showing the average of last 3 readings |
| Battery Icon | Indicates battery level. Replace when icon is empty or flashing. |
| Date & Time | Displayed in memory recall mode |
The device stores the last 100 readings with date and time.
Note: Memory is retained when batteries are removed or replaced.

| Symptom | Possible Cause | Corrective Action |
|---|---|---|
| Display is blank | Dead batteries, improper installation | Replace all 4 batteries; ensure correct polarity. Check AC adapter connection if using. |
| Error Symbol 'E' appears | Cuff not connected, air leak, cuff wrapped incorrectly | Ensure cuff tube is plugged in firmly. Re-wrap cuff snugly on bare arm. Check cuff for holes/leaks. |
| Irregular Heartbeat Symbol flashes | Irregular rhythm detected during measurement | Remain still and take another measurement. If symbol appears frequently, consult your physician. |
| Body Movement Symbol appears | Excessive movement during inflation/deflation | Sit still, rest arm comfortably, and retake measurement without moving or talking. |
| Reading seems unusually high/low | Incorrect posture, cuff position, recent activity | Rest for 5 minutes before measuring. Ensure cuff is at heart level. Follow measurement instructions precisely. |
| Memory does not recall | Memory cleared, unit malfunction | Check if memory was accidentally cleared. If problem persists, contact service. |
Reset: Remove batteries and AC adapter for 1 minute, then reinstall.
